Arkema Rilsan® BMN Y TLD Nylon 11, MoS2 Filled
Categories: Polymer; Thermoplastic; Nylon (Polyamide PA); Nylon 11 (PA11)

Material Notes: Designation ISO 1874-PA11,MHLR,12-020,MD05

Rigid grade with molybdenum filler for injection molding. Available color: steel gray. Light and heat stabilized. Mold release agent.

No need of lubricant. Low friction coefficient. Abrasion resistance. Outstanding mechanical properties. Easy filling of the mold due to its well adapted melt viscosity. Low shrinkage: include 1% on average for the design of the mold. Very good dimensional stability (low moisture absorption).

UL classification: UL94 V2 (3,05mm) RTI(C) 105/90/105

Example applications: Moving mechanical parts with friction such as gear or bearing.

Information provided by Arkema.

Key Words: PA11; Polyamide 11

Physical PropertiesOriginal ValueComments
Density 1.04 g/ccISO 1183
 1.04 g/ccCond.; ISO 1183
Water Absorption 1.9 %Dry; Sim. to ISO 62
Melt Flow 36 g/10 min
@Load 2.16 kg,
Temperature 235 °C
cm³/10 min Volumetric Rate; ISO 1133
 
Mechanical PropertiesOriginal ValueComments
Hardness, Shore D 70
@Time 15.0 sec
Dry; ISO 7619-1
Tensile Strength, Yield 45.0 MPaCond.; ISO 527-1/-2
Elongation at Break >= 50 %Cond.; ISO 527-1/-2
Elongation at Yield 3.0 %Cond.; ISO 527-1/-2
Tensile Modulus 1600 MPaCond.; ISO 527-1/-2
 
Electrical PropertiesOriginal ValueComments
Volume Resistivity 1.00e+14 ohm-cmCond.; IEC 60093
Surface Resistance 1.00e+14 ohmCond.; IEC 60093
Dielectric Constant 3.0
@Frequency 1e+6 Hz
Dry; IEC 60250
 4.0
@Frequency 100 Hz
Dry; IEC 60250
Dielectric Strength 55.0 kV/mmCond.; IEC 60243-1
Dissipation Factor 0.0212
@Frequency 1e+6 Hz
Dry; IEC 60250
 0.0545
@Frequency 100 Hz
Dry; IEC 60250
Comparative Tracking Index 600 VCond.; IEC 60112
 
Thermal PropertiesOriginal ValueComments
CTE, linear, Parallel to Flow 90.0 µm/m-°CDry; ISO 11359-1/-2
Melting Point 189 °C10°C/min; Dry; ISO 11357-1/-3
Deflection Temperature at 0.46 MPa (66 psi) 155 °CDry; ISO 75-1/-2
Deflection Temperature at 1.8 MPa (264 psi) 50.0 °CDry; ISO 75-1/-2
Vicat Softening Point 162 °C50°C/h 50N; Dry; ISO 306
Flammability, UL94 V-2
@Thickness 1.60 mm
Yellow Card Available; Dry; IEC 60695-11-10
 
Processing PropertiesOriginal ValueComments
Melt Temperature 270 °CInjection Molding; ISO 294
Mold Temperature 50.0 °CInjection Molding; ISO 10724
Hold Pressure 16.0 MPaInjection Molding; ISO 294
 
Descriptive Properties
%Bio-Based98ASTM D6866
Bio-BasedYes
Form as DeliveredPellets
Heat StabilizedYes
Light StabilizedYes
Moisture SensitiveYes
Processing MethodsInjection Molding
Release agentYes
